Teacher Certification

 

Admission to the Teacher Education Program

Undergraduate students must meet the following requirements to be admitted into the Teacher Education Program:

  • Complete the Application for Admission to the Teacher Education Program.
  • Complete a minimum of 36 semester hours of college credit.
  • Achieve a Content GPA of 3.0 or higher and a Professional Education GPA of 3.0 or higher with no grade lower than a C in any professional education courses.
  • Complete the following courses with a grade of "C" or better:
    EDFL 2100 Introduction to the Teaching Profession
    FLDX 2150 Introductory Field Experience
    EDFL 2240 Educational Psychology
    EDSP 2100 Education of the Exceptional Child
  • Request a Program Recommendation for Admission to Teacher Education from your faculty mentor.
  • Pass a background check through the approved DESE agent.
  • Pass the below sections of the Missouri General Education Assessment (MoGEA). 
    • UCM Passing Scores for MoGEA Subsections:
      • Reading  - 183
      • Writing - 167
      • Math - 180
